Flutter Front-End Developer
J
Flutter Front-End Developer at JAN3
About Us
We are a Bitcoin technology company focused on expanding access to Bitcoin and financial freedom around the world. We aim to provide tools for individuals, enterprises, and countries to benefit and be part of a free and open financial system based on Bitcoin.
The Role
This position involves developing the AQUA Wallet app. The core requirement is that the candidate can develop Flutter apps, work independently, communicate effectively when blockers arise, and take initiative in resolving them and driving progress. We are a lean team with a largely flat organizational structure, where everyone is expected to operate autonomously and push development forward.
Responsibilities
- Be able to code UI and business logic in Flutter apps (including interacting with underlying Bitcoin and cryptographic libraries, as well as with backend and third-party web services)
- Communicate with other team members when issues or blockers arise and drive them to completion
- Contribute to the code review process
Requirements
- Knowledge of Flutter/Dart and Python
- Experience developing Flutter apps for both iOS and Android
- Some familiarity with the technical aspects of how Bitcoin works
Additional Skills Preferred
- Knowledge of Rust
- Experience deploying apps to the Google Play Store and Apple App Store
- Expertise in Bitcoin, Liquid, and Lightning
- Familiarity with GDK, LDK, and Breez SDK